What is BrightnessControl

BrightnessControl refers to the ability to adjust the intensity of light emitted from a digital screen. This feature allows users to increase or decrease screen brightness depending on their surroundings and personal preferences.

For example, when using a device in bright sunlight, users may increase the brightness to make the screen easier to see. In darker environments such as at night, reducing brightness helps prevent eye discomfort.

Most modern devices include built-in brightness settings that allow users to control the screen light quickly through system settings or quick-access controls.

Types of BrightnessControl Settings

Most modern devices offer different ways to control screen brightness. These options help users adjust their screens according to their needs.

Manual Brightness Adjustment

Manual brightness control allows users to set the brightness level themselves. This is usually done through the device settings or quick-access brightness slider.

Users can increase or decrease brightness instantly based on their environment.

Automatic Brightness

Automatic brightness uses sensors that detect surrounding light conditions. The device automatically adjusts the screen brightness based on the amount of light in the environment.

For example, in a dark room the screen becomes dimmer, while in bright outdoor conditions it becomes brighter.

Adaptive Brightness

Adaptive brightness is an advanced feature that learns from user behavior. Over time, the device remembers preferred brightness levels in different environments and adjusts automatically.

This feature helps create a personalized viewing experience.

BrightnessControl for Eye Health

Eye health is an important consideration when using digital screens. Long hours of screen exposure can cause digital eye strain, which includes symptoms such as dry eyes, blurred vision, and headaches.

BrightnessControl helps reduce these problems by allowing users to match screen brightness with the surrounding lighting conditions. Screens that are too bright compared to the environment can cause discomfort.

In addition to adjusting brightness, users can follow other practices such as taking regular breaks from screens and maintaining proper viewing distance to protect eye health.

BrightnessControl in Different Devices

Brightness control features are available on many types of electronic devices.

Smartphones and tablets allow users to adjust brightness through quick settings menus or system preferences. Many mobile devices also include automatic brightness features.

Laptop and desktop computers provide brightness controls through keyboard shortcuts or operating system settings. Some monitors also include physical buttons to adjust brightness.

Televisions and smart displays also offer brightness settings that improve picture quality and viewing comfort.

Each device may offer slightly different controls, but the purpose remains the same: to provide a comfortable viewing experience.
